Company Description

Nexthink is the leader in digital employee experience management software. The company provides IT leaders with unprecedented insight allowing them to see, diagnose and fix issues at scale impacting employees anywhere, with any application or network, before employees notice the issue. As the first solution to allow IT to progress from reactive problem solving to proactive optimization, Nexthink enables its more than 1,200 customers to provide better digital experiences to more than 15 million employees. Dual headquartered in Lausanne, Switzerland and Boston, Massachusetts, Nexthink has 9 offices worldwide.

Job Description

We are seeking a seasoned accounting professional to build and lead the technical accounting function, reporting directly to the Head of Corporate Accounting. This role will serve as the subject matter expert on complex areas such as revenue recognition, purchase accounting, equity and debt, stock-based compensation, and impairment testing. The ideal candidate will also drive cross-functional initiatives, including M&A, system implementations, and other strategic projects.

Key Responsibilities:

  • lead all the technical accounting, revenue accounting, and internal controls.
  • Being the subject matter expert in revenue accounting, purchase accounting, pension accounting, stock-based compensation, 409A valuation, equity accounting, debt accounting, goodwill and intangible asset impairment testing, R&D capitalization, and other non-routine and complex transactions; independently research technical accounting topics and prepare whitepapers.
  • Lead and drive the enhancement of global accounting policies; collaborate with cross functional teams and business owners to implement new accounting policies and procedures.
  • Lead the preparation of US GAAP consolidated financial statements and footnotes.
  • Lead operational process audit, on a need basis; drive the enhancement of Internal Controls over Financial Reporting (“ICFR”).
  • Oversee the revenue accounting close and support other accounting close activities, as needed.
  • Support the annual audit of consolidated financial statements under US GAAP and statutory audit of the Switzerland holding company.
  • Liaise with the global tax manager to support US GAAP income tax reporting and provision.
  • Be the backup for team members, as needed.
  • Proactively identify opportunities for process improvement and system optimization.
  • Assist in ad-hoc projects (e.g. M&A due diligence, M&A integration, system implementation, tax audit, financing, etc.) for the Finance organization as needed.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
